首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

eclipse使用maven创建web3.0项目

挺别扭,eclipse和maven发展了这么久,二者都没有很好解决这个问题。 默认情况下,使用maven骨架撞见webapp只支持servlet2.3,eclipse又不允许随便修改为3.0。...我梳理了一种办法,感觉处理起来相对合理,如下: 1.创建普通webapp项目 点击菜单“File - New - Other - Maven - Maven Project”; Next; Next...选项卡; 建议:选中junit 3.8.1,点击"Properties",版本改为"4.12"; 点击"Add",在搜索框输入javax.servlet-api,选择"javax.servlet"开头依赖...右键点击项目目录,选择"Run As - Maven build..."...右键点击项目名,依次选择"Configure - Convert to Maven Project"。 右键点击项目名,选择"Maven - Update Project..."。

61420
您找到你想要的搜索结果了吗?
是的
没有找到

使用Maven创建web项目

使用eclipse插件创建一个web project 首先创建一个MavenProject如下图 我们勾选上Create a simple project (不使用骨架) 这里Packing...选择 war形式 由于packing是war包,那么下面也就多出了webapp目录 由于我们项目使用eclipse发布到tomcat下面,这里我们需要先把项目转成dynamic web project...并点击ok  如下图:(3.0只有tomcat7才支持) 接下来观察我们项目结构,多了一个web content目录 虽然此时我们可以发布到tomcat中,但这不符合maven结构,我们还要做如下修改...tomcat中 补充:我们需要在src/main/webapp/WEB-INF下面创建一个web.xml 导入我们Spring mvc依赖jar包 <dependency...就会自动为我们下载所需jar文件

1K80

Maven 入门教程】4、如何使用 IDEA 创建 Maven 项目

接着我们又介绍了如何安装和配置 Maven,再接着,我们又了解了 Maven 中常用一些命令以及如何利用 Archetype 来生成项目骨架,并对利用 Maven 所生成项目的结构进行了描述。...最后则是 Maven一些核心概念和如何进行依赖管理,并说明当依赖产生冲突时,应该如何解决。但以上始终还是停留在概念阶段,并未进入我们实际开发中。...那么今天内容就主要来看看,我们如何利用 IDEA 搭配 Maven 来开发一个简单 Demo。...使用 IDEA 创建 Maven 项目 接下来我们就来看看如何使用 IDEA 创建 Maven 项目,具体可以分为如下步骤: 首先一次进入 File -> New -> Project,然后选择 Maven...业务代码编写 上面已经学会了如何创建一个 Maven 项目,接下来就是编写业务代码了,我们以最经典 HelloWorld 为例。

4K30

Maven如何手动添加依赖jar文件到本地Maven仓库

大家肯定遇到过想在pom文件中加入自己开发依赖包,这些包肯定是不是在Maven仓库(http://repo1.maven.org/maven2/)。...那我们怎么将那些不存在Maven仓库中包加入到本地Maven库中呢?很简单。这里以IKAnalyzer.jar包为例进行讲解。   ...第一步:将IKAnalyzer.jar包存放在一个文件夹中,比如mylib文件夹   第二步:建一个IKAnalyzer.jar包相关pom.xml文件,需要在pom.xml中定义其maven坐标及其相应依赖代码即可...,同样将pom文件存放在上述jar文件同一文件夹下,IKAnalyzer.jar坐标及依赖代码如下: <project xmlns="http://<em>maven</em>.apache.org/POM/4.0.0"...之后你可以在pom.xml文件中通过以下依赖项目中引入上述包,如下:                   org.wltea.ik-analyzer</

1.3K10

maven: 打包可运行jar包(java application)及依赖处理

类,然后用mvn exec:exec来运行,但是部署到生产环境中时,服务器上通常并不具备maven环境,只能用 java -jar xxx.jar这种方式来运行,下面是一些处理细节: 一、依赖处理...java application运行时需要查找依赖第三方jar,如果查找classpath失败,就会报错,可以先用 mvn dependency:copy-dependencies -DoutputDirectory...=target/lib 命令,把依赖jar包全部导出到target/lib这个目录下 二、利用maven-jar-plugin修改META-INF\MANIFEST.MF 清单文件 java application...其中第4行指定了classpath,也就是所依赖jar包在什么地方,第6行表示main函数入口类,默认情况下mvn clean package生成jar包里,清单文件上并没有这2行,需要在pom.xml...,这样mvn package后,清单文件里就会自动添加Main-Class和Class-Path这二 ok了,部署时把jar包和lib目录,都上传到服务器上 ,然后测试一下,顺利的话 java -jar

2K90

使用Maven Archetype创建Java项目模板

当我们试图提供一个提供生成Maven项目的一致方法系统时,这个名字就合适了。Archetype将帮助作者为用户创建Maven项目模板,并为用户提供生成这些项目模板参数化版本方法。...一旦创建了这些原型并将其部署在组织存储库中,组织中所有开发人员就可以使用它们。...---- 2.do it ⚠️:我们将使用springboot项目来演示如何生成一个maven archetype(原型),本文中(模板)(原型)交替使用,二者意思相同。...maven archetype来创建以该项目为基础模板。...---- 3.summary 本文我们介绍maven原型及其特性带来好处,并且我们演示了如何生成一个原型,并且利用原型来创建一个新项目

1.2K10

webstorm 使用git_idea使用maven创建web项目

,我相信现在一定有许多小伙伴并不知道如何用它操作 GIT 吧;         而 WebStrom 主要用于前端开发,当我们用到JS或者其他框架时,无需安装插件,下载即可使用,开发流畅度自然会很高,虽无各类插件但像代码整理等便捷功能它一样不少...与 IntelliJ IDEA 同源,继承了 IntelliJ IDEA 强大 JS 部分功能。         小马在这里使用是 WebSrtrom 2018.3 英文版。...i 命令下载 node_modules 包; 7.下载完modules包之后就可以正常启动项目了; ---- 三、更新项目代码         在使用 Git 协同开发环境下,每次打开 webstorm...,右键 -> Git -> Revert 即可恢复; 当文件名为红色时表示该文件为新创建文件且未上传至仓库,仅存在于本地; 想要删除此新创建文件时,若该文件未被其他文件引用则无需安全删除,直接删除即可...,避免产生冲突) 2.提交时必须写明备注,提交时注意选择自己确定要提交代码文件,不提交不要选择,提交成功会有成功提示且会在版本控制中生成提交记录;提交成功后文件名变为正常颜色; 3.若想要提交新创建文件

1.2K30

从初识Maven使用Maven进行依赖管理和项目构建

---- (五)在eclipse中配置Maven 我们之前在eclipse中创建项目,那个使用eclipse中自带Maven插件,我们想要用自己安装Maven,需要在eclipse中配置: ?...---- (六)创建Maven项目容易出现问题 在创建Maven项目后老是会出现一些问题: ①jdk版本出错 Maven(我这个版本)默认是使用jdk1.5,如果你想要使用自己jdk的话需要右击项目...---- (八)依赖范围 在我们设置依赖时候,会有一Scope,里面有: ? compile,provided,runtime,test,system五。 ?...解决方案: 其实Maven不会让这两个jar包冲突,它有一套默认调节原则: ①声明优先原则: 如果B依赖C和D依赖C冲突,那么使用B依赖C jar包,因为B提前导入。...②最短路径原则: 如果我们就是想要使用D依赖C jar包,我们只需要自己手动add依赖即可,Maven优先使用我们手动添加依赖

1.4K70
领券